Join us on Tuesday, April 22, at 6 p.m. in TM-11 as we commemorate the 110th anniversary of the Armenian Genocide. Keynote speaker and historian Michael Rettig will share his family's story of survival and resettlement in Fresno, reflecting the experiences of many Armenian families marked by hardship, loss, and resilience. Let's honor their legacy and reflect on this enduring history.
This event is free and open to the public, and parking is available.
